We are looking for a highly organised and proactive administrator to join our School-Aged Health Improvement and Prevention Service, supporting the delivery of preventative health programmes for children and young people across Cambridgeshire and Peterborough.
The service works with schools, colleges and community settings to improve health and wellbeing outcomes through education, early intervention and partnership working. As Youth Health Improvement Administrator, you will play a vital role in ensuring the smooth running of service activity, communications and office processes.
You will provide administrative and communications support across key areas including sexual health, smoking and vaping prevention and Healthy Schools Accreditation. Working closely with co-ordinators, practitioners and managers, you will help ensure resources are organised, partners are supported, and services are effectively promoted to education and community settings.
